** Semis down 4 pct and lead losses as tech sectorbackpedals and drags S&P500 and Nasdaq lower
** Weak PC sales, pullback in growth stocks cited as reasonsby one trader at a U.S. bulge-bracket who adds concerns buildingover Q2 forecasts which should be out over next few weeks
** UBS downgrade of Advanced Micro Devices to "sell"from "neutral" sends stock down 7.7 pct
** Weak US durable goods report lends to worries that strongdollar means chipmakers holding off on ordering newmanufacturing equipment, analyst says
** Skyworks Solutions, Lam Research, AvagoTech, NXP Semiconductor drop 3-6 pct
** US chip equipment makers KLA-Tencor, AppliedMaterials fall 3-5 pct
** Apple off 1.8 pct
** Close below the March 12 low for the Philadelphia SESemiconductor Index would be bearish
** Sharp move lower in U.S. tech hit European chipmakers
